DRIAN FRANCISCO'S MANAGER RECEIVED MIJARES FIGHT CONTRACT
By Ronnie Nathanielsz PhilBoxing.com Fri, 13 Aug 2010

The youthful manager of WBA super flyweight interim champion Drian Francisco has informed insidesports.ph that he has received the contract for a fight against reigning North American Boxing Federation bantamweight champion Christian Mijares from well-known promoter Fernando Beltran of Zanfer Promotions and is studying the details.
Elmer Anuran said the fight will be held sometime in October in Mexico and that he was not aware of a statement by WBC/WBO bantamweight champion Fernando Montiel that a fight between him and Mijares was being talked about for September.
Anuran told us that Mijares wants to go back to fighting as a super flyweight in order to face Francisco who is undefeated with a record of 19-0-1 with 15 knockouts. Mijares, on the other hand, is a clinically sound boxer with a record of 39-6-2 with 17 knockouts.
Francisco?s manager told us the fight is likely to take place either on October 9 or 16 in Mexico and that Francisco will fly to Los Angeles in September to continue his training at the Wild Card Gym of Freddie Roach although Roach is expected to be in Manila at that time as pound-for-pound king Manny Pacquiao prepares for his planned title fight against Antonio Margarito.
Anuran told us earlier ?it doesn?t matter if the fight will be in Mexico. This will be the opening of the door for Drian to be recognized in the world and the international market.? He said Francisco is ?capable and ready to fight anyone, anywhere.?
